For most of my life, my love was confined to my wife, daughter, family, and close friends. God was not on the short list. I had respect for God, and a dose of fear, but love did not really enter into the equation. Certainly, I never thought of God as being defined by love. I never thought of God loving me and his commandment that I release that love to all others around me.
With other people outside my circle of friends and family, I did not think in terms of love. In fact, I more often looked for the bad rather than the good in people. I actually use to look for people to screw up so I could just shake my head in disgust. That’s what you do when you have a strong dose of self-righteousness like I had for most of my life. It’s impossible to look eye-to-eye with others and love them. You look down on others, especially those who you think are less “perfect” than you.
Fortunately, understanding that God is love, and calls us to love, has changed my whole perspective on life. Yes, there are certainly times when my ability to love is tested.
We have two exits from the church parking lot, both on to a very busy street. It is almost impossible to make a left turn, let alone simply make a right. Last week I made a right turn out of the farthest exit and then stopped in front the other exit to let cars out. The person behind me was so indignant that he not only blared his horn but after 20 seconds actually passed me on the right shoulder, almost causing an accident with a car exiting the lot. Yes, I couldn’t believe what he did but what flashed in my head was that is exactly what I, Mr. Impatient, would have done not long ago.
It’s sometimes hard to love. Those are the times when I think about how much God loves me, regardless of what I have done. The ultimate judge and power does not judge and lord over me. He loves me and simply expects me to do the same with everyone around me. There are no exceptions.
